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
176 2769737 22238087 79644
361977856 8876
361977856 8876
416 8148469500 8443
All about undefined
Interested in learning more?
361977856 8876
416 8148469500 8443
See more
1905724 43356 70096022
711774 613273660 65608107688 68219947
See more
6710903 081
34179 59438 2643 939544890
See more